Dissecting the Mystery: How Short URLs Function

Ever clicked on a URL that seemed impossibly short, wondering how it could possibly lead to a full-blown website? Those compact links are no mere illusions; they're cleverly crafted using technology called URL shortening. Essentially, these services take lengthy web addresses and convert them into shorter, more manageable versions.

Behind the scenes, a database acts as the magic switch. When you submit a shortened URL, your browser requests information from this database. The database then discovers the original, full-length URL associated with the short code and channels your browser to the intended destination.

  • Such a system offers several advantages, including easier sharing on social media platforms where character limits can be restrictive.
  • Moreover, short URLs are less prone to typos and look cleaner in emails or online documents.
  • On the flip side that some users may hesitate about clicking on shortened URLs, as a result of potential security risks. Always double-check the source of a short URL before tapping it.
